The article from MSN discusses how former President Donald Trump has decided to delay imposing new tariffs on imported automobiles, a move influenced by both market pressures and pushback from Republican lawmakers. This decision comes amidst concerns over potential economic repercussions, including higher costs for consumers and retaliatory measures from trade partners. The delay reflects Trump's ongoing struggle to balance his protectionist trade policies with the realities of global trade dynamics and domestic political considerations. The article highlights the tension between Trump's desire to protect U.S. auto manufacturers and the broader economic implications of such tariffs, illustrating the complex interplay of economic policy, international relations, and domestic politics.
